I am a Fellow of the American College of Obstetrics and Gynecology (FACOG). I’ve been in practice for nearly Fourteen years. I am Board certified (Diplomat of American Board of OBGYN) and have taken certified trainings to perform minimally invasive surgeries utilizing the most current technology in the surgical arena – da Vinci and Olympus 3-D. My interests include strong commitment to patient education, research in women’s health care, and teaching.
I’ve extensive experience in the diagnosis and treatment of a wide range of women’s diseases, especially dealing with the female reproductive system, performing advanced gynecologic surgeries, including diagnostic, emergency, and Urogyn procedures. I’ve an outstanding ability to provide care with emphasis on a holistic approach, treating the female patient as a physical, emotional, and social being.
Meghan Lainoff, PA-C is a board-certified Physician Assistant who joined Charles County Dermatology Associates in 2024. She is licensed to practice in both Maryland and Virginia. Meghan's journey into Dermatology began over a decade ago when she worked as a Medical Assistant while earning her Bachelor of Science in Neuroscience from George Mason University.
In 2018, Meghan completed her master's in physician assistant studies at Radford University Carilion in Roanoke, Virginia and has since gained valuable clinical and procedural experience working in interventional Pulmonology and Neurosurgery. Her diverse background as a Physician Assistant allows her to provide well rounded, high-quality care to every patient.
Originally from a military family. Meghan has called the DMV are home since 2001. When she is not serving patients, Meghan enjoys spending time with her family, cuddling with her pets, and baking.
Jacob Aja, PA-C is a board certified physician assistant who joined the practice in 2021. He completed his undergraduate training at Boise State University. He then went on to earn his Masters in Physicians Assistant studies in 2007. He began his career in orthopedics but developed a love for Dermatology which guided him to join Charles County Dermatology. He is an active member of AAPA and Society of Dermatology Physician Assistants. He is trained in the diagnosis and treatment of skin cancer, acne, rosacea, psoriasis, eczema, hair loss and other dermatologic problems. He is also trained to perform cosmetic procedures.
